Inframation 2002 to bring together nation’s preventive maintenance workers

Aug. 14, 2002
Plant maintenance workers interested in learning more about infrared inspections, preventive maintenance, thermal research and development, online process monitoring and control, or nondestructive testing should clear out Sept. 29 – Oct. 2, 2002 on their Franklin planners for InfraMation 2002, the third annual thermographers’ conference hosted by the Infrared Training Center (ITC) and Flir Systems.

Attendees to the conference, which takes place at the Wyndham Orlando Resort in Orlando, Fla., will have 35 presentations and interactive discussions from industry professionals, ITC instructors, and thermographers to choose from during the four-day event.

In addition to the seminars and speeches, free IR applications and software clinics led by ITC instructors will also be available to attendees. For those interested in the latest in preventive maintenance products, the conference will also feature an exhibitors’ showcase.
